Your smartphone gets a dynamic IP address from your ISP, so it’s not a static address. ISPs don’t have enough static IP addresses to provide a dedicated IP for each user. So they assign you an IP address for temporary use and give you a different one after a renewal period. Some ISPs also use network address translation to give you an IP
To change your settings on a router: In your browser, enter the IP address of your router to view the router's administration console. Most routers are manufactured to use a default address such as 192.168.0.1, 192.168.1.1, 192.168.2.1, or 192.168.1.100. If none of these work, try to find the default gateway address in the network settings
